    The Science of Load Calculation

    Manual J is the industry-standard method for calculating residential heating and cooling loads, developed by ACCA (Air Conditioning Contractors of America). It takes into account your home's square footage, insulation levels, window types and orientation, climate zone, number of occupants, and other factors to determine exactly how much heating and cooling capacity your home needs. The result is expressed in BTUs per hour. For GREC programs, this precision is vital. It prevents the 'oversizing' of systems which can lead to inefficient operation and ensures that the thermal output utilized in the GREC formula is based on actual building physics rather than guesswork.     The Impact of Building Materials on Load

    The details within your Manual J report reveal how your specific building materials affect your geothermal needs. For example, a home with triple-pane windows and high-density spray foam insulation will have a significantly different load profile than an older home with traditional fiberglass batts. The Manual J accounts for the 'U-value' and 'R-value' of these components to give a holistic view of the thermal resistance of your structure. This level of detail is crucial for GREC registration because it explains why a 3-ton system might be sufficient for a 3,000-square-foot high-performance home while a 5-ton system is needed elsewhere.     State-Specific Requirements and Documentation

    Virginia's GREC program explicitly requires a Manual J load calculation as part of the registration documentation. Maryland's program recommends it but may accept alternative documentation of system capacity. New Hampshire follows its own documentation requirements, often focusing on AHRI certificates in conjunction with load data. Regardless of state requirements, having a Manual J on file is always beneficial — it speeds up the certification process and reduces the likelihood of questions from state reviewers.     How to Obtain Your Manual J report

    A Manual J calculation is typically performed by your HVAC contractor, geothermal installer, or a home energy auditor. The process involves a site visit to assess your home's envelope characteristics. Cost typically ranges from $150 to $500 depending on your area. Many geothermal installers include a Manual J as part of their standard installation process because it is required for proper equipment selection. If your installer performed one during installation, they should have it on file.     Beyond Registration: The Value of Accurate Sizing

    While the Manual J is a tool for GREC registration, its value extends to the comfort and efficiency of your home. A system that was properly sized using Manual J protocols will cycle more efficiently, maintain better humidity control, and have a longer operational life. These factors indirectly help your GREC revenue by ensuring the system is running optimally year-round. An incorrectly sized system that short-cycles will not produce the same consistent thermal output as one that is perfectly matched to the home's load. A system that is too large for the space will reach the thermostat setpoint too quickly, never allowing the heat pump to reach its peak operating efficiency. Conversely, an undersized system will rely too heavily on expensive auxiliary electric resistance heat, which does not count toward your GREC total. The Manual J ensures that the bulk of your heating comes from the renewable earth loop, maximizing both your comfort and your monthly credit checks.
